What do you think about this approach?: make a lookup table for all powers of four!

    fastest C++ code
    A fellow coder, made a switch/case clause and switched between all possible powers of four. For a 32 bits integer, there are only 16 of them! Personally I think this is the correct way of checking if a number is power of four, if our code is assumed to be run millions of times and performance matters. What are your thoughts?

